Summary:

Zip code 36527, encompassing the Spanish Fort and Loxley area of Alabama, is home to three elementary schools—Spanish Fort Elementary School, Rockwell Elementary School, and Stonebridge Elementary—all serving grades PK through 6 within the Baldwin County district, which itself ranks in the top quarter of Alabama districts.

These schools are standout performers, with all three ranking in the 85th percentile or higher statewide. Rockwell Elementary is the academic leader, earning a 5-star rating and the highest state rank (59th of 686), along with the best math scores in the zip code and the lowest student-to-teacher ratio at 12.9:1. Spanish Fort Elementary is a close second, also earning 5 stars and posting the highest English scores in 5th grade (90.57%) and the best science scores in 4th grade (75.76%). Stonebridge Elementary, while ranked slightly lower (102nd), boasts the lowest chronic absenteeism rate in the area at just 3.6%—a third of the state average—and the lowest percentage of students receiving free/reduced lunch (13.87%).

Across the board, these schools dramatically outperform state averages, particularly in English Language Arts, where proficiency rates range from 75% to 92.77% compared to state averages in the 56-69% range. Chronic absenteeism is exceptionally low across all three schools (3.6% to 7.0% vs. 12% statewide), and math performance, while more variable, still exceeds state norms. One notable area for attention is the significant decline in 5th grade math at Spanish Fort Elementary, which dropped from 74.29% to 49.06% year-over-year. Overall, this zip code offers a highly supportive educational environment with strong family engagement, making it an excellent choice for families prioritizing academic achievement.
